United States Underwater Ultrasonic Thickness Gauge Market by Type

An underwater ultrasonic thickness gauge is a crucial tool used in various industries including marine, offshore, and underwater construction to measure the thickness of materials such as metal, plastic, and composites without requiring direct access to both sides of the material. In the United States, this market segment is witnessing significant growth due to increasing investments in offshore energy exploration, maintenance of underwater structures, and stringent regulations regarding structural integrity and safety.

There are several types of underwater ultrasonic thickness gauges available in the US market, each designed for specific applications and environments. The most common types include portable handheld gauges, which are compact and versatile, ideal for quick inspections in confined spaces. These gauges typically feature digital displays and are capable of measuring a wide range of materials and thicknesses with high accuracy.

Fixed mounted gauges are another category, commonly used in permanent installations such as on offshore platforms and underwater pipelines. These gauges provide continuous monitoring capabilities, transmitting real-time thickness data to control rooms for immediate analysis and decision-making. The demand for fixed mounted gauges is driven by the need for ongoing maintenance and monitoring of critical infrastructure.

For specialized applications such as ultrasonic thickness measurement on curved surfaces or in hard-to-reach areas underwater, companies offer custom-designed gauges that cater to unique operational requirements. These solutions often integrate advanced features such as flexible probes and enhanced data processing capabilities to ensure accurate measurements even in challenging conditions.
